from Questa Overview The Rocket is made of 2 liter bottles and is launched using water and pressure. The water Rocket only works on Sir Isaac Newton's Third law. The third law states “For every action, there is an equal and opposite reaction.” Obesation Fold parachute and put the parachute in the deployer. Next,stretch the rubber band over the parachute deployer,and put it a pin 2.Then,hold the cardboard.Flap down and put the lock flap in the lock pin.Pour 600-750 mL of water and put it on the launcher.It is pressurized using a bicycle pump.After 15-20 pumps,the water rocket is ready to be released.With the explosion of water,the rocket shoots up in the air. As the rocket,the air pressure on the top unlocks the the lock pin.While the rocket goes up,speed decreases and the pressure on the cardboard flap decreases.As the results, The cardboard flap comes up, releasing From the pin. Thus The parachute opens and will float all the way down as slow as possible.
